EU CE Machinery Regulation Update: CNC Machine Re-Certification Surges

May 04 2026

Starting May 1, 2026, the mandatory application of EN ISO 13857:2026 has triggered a sharp rise in CE re-certification requests for machine tools exported from China to the EU — with implications for manufacturers, exporters, and supply chain service providers handling industrial machinery compliance.

Event Overview

Effective May 1, 2026, EN ISO 13857:2026 became fully enforceable across the European Union. According to feedback from European Notified Bodies (NBs), applications for full-machine CE safety re-certification submitted by Chinese machine tool exporters increased by 217% year-on-year during the first week. Certification service providers confirmed that over 65% of these applications involve reassessment of three specific requirements: protective measures for human–machine collaboration zones, redundancy in emergency stop circuits, and revalidation of safety distances.

Industries Affected

Direct Exporters of Machine Tools

Exporters face immediate compliance pressure: products lacking updated CE certification may be detained at EU customs. This affects delivery timelines, contractual penalties, and buyer trust — particularly for orders under Incoterms such as DAP or DDP where exporters retain responsibility through clearance.

Machine Tool Manufacturers (OEMs)

OEMs must verify whether their current designs meet revised safety distance calculations and control system architecture requirements under EN ISO 13857:2026. Retrofitting legacy models or redesigning control logic may delay production cycles and require coordination with component suppliers.

Component Suppliers (e.g., Safety Controllers, Light Curtains, E-Stop Modules)

Suppliers providing safety-critical subsystems are indirectly affected: OEMs now request updated technical documentation and conformity evidence aligned with the new standard. Requests for updated declarations of conformity (DoC) and integration test reports have risen notably.

Certification & Compliance Service Providers

Service providers report a 300% increase in consultation volume for full-machine CE re-certification. Workloads are concentrated on technical file review, risk assessment updates, and verification testing — especially for collaborative robot-integrated machine tools and multi-axis CNC systems.

What Enterprises and Practitioners Should Monitor and Do

Track official NB guidance and interpretation notes

Notified Bodies are issuing clarifications on transitional arrangements and acceptable evidence for legacy installations. Enterprises should monitor communications from their assigned NB and avoid relying solely on third-party summaries.

Prioritize high-volume or high-risk product categories

Re-certification demand is concentrated among machines featuring human–machine interaction (e.g., CNC lathes with manual loading, milling centers with teach-pendant operation). Exporters should triage based on shipment volume, EU market share, and pending order commitments.

Distinguish regulatory signal from operational readiness

The 217% surge reflects initial application volume, not completed certifications. Lead times for full-machine assessments remain unchanged — typically 8–12 weeks — meaning delays in certification completion could cascade into Q3 2026 shipments.

Prepare technical documentation and supplier coordination early

Manufacturers should audit existing technical files against EN ISO 13857:2026 Annex A and B requirements, and engage component suppliers to confirm updated safety-related performance data — especially for safety relays, programmable safety controllers, and presence-sensing devices.

Editorial Observation / Industry Perspective

Observably, this surge is less an indication of widespread noncompliance and more a reflection of procedural timing: many Chinese exporters had deferred full-machine CE renewal until the mandatory enforcement date. Analysis shows the jump primarily captures pent-up demand rather than a sudden deterioration in design conformity. From an industry perspective, it signals growing maturity in export-oriented manufacturers’ awareness of harmonized standards — but also highlights persistent gaps in embedded safety engineering capacity. Current developments are best understood as a near-term compliance checkpoint, not a structural shift in EU market access rules. Continued monitoring is warranted, particularly regarding how NBs handle borderline cases involving retrofit versus new-build configurations.

This update underscores that CE conformity for machine tools is no longer a one-time administrative step but an iterative process tied to evolving safety science and integration complexity. For stakeholders, the priority remains accurate scoping, disciplined documentation management, and proactive NB engagement — not accelerated certification alone.
